Mobile Internet services were snapped in three districts of Kashmir Valley, including the summer capital, as a precautionary measure to maintain law and order.

The services have been barred in Srinagar, Anantnag and Pulwama districts of the valley, a police official said.

He said the decision to suspend the services has been taken as a precautionary measure to maintain law and order.
